Rathore to spend whole June in jail
Chandigarh, June 4: Former Haryana DGP S.P.S. Rathore, who is serving an 18-month jail sentence in Ruchika Girhotra molestation case, will remain behind bars till the end of this month as the Punjab and Haryana High Court on Friday, June 4 denied him relief saying that he had been found guilty of an “odious offense".
Vacation judge Justice Ajay Tewari fixed June 29 for hearing, before an “appropriate" bench, on the revised petition filed by the 68-year-old Rathore for suspension of the sentence and his bail.
The judge said that normally where the sentence is up to three years, bail should be granted liberally but with regards to this case he said, "In a case like the present, where the accused has been found guilty of a particularly odious offense, this rule can be departed from," the judge observed.
With the judge fixing June 29 for hearing arguments on the revision petition filed on Rathore"s behalf by his lawyer-wife Abha, the former top cop will have to remain behind bars.
